Signs of fake UK pound coins are >
Wrong year for reverse design
Sometimes obverse and reverse not aligned
The edge is poorly done
and so on ...
If you look down that link I gave, I added in different replies
various pictures of edge and alignment to show what to look for.
On yours is the edge poorly done; is the reverse vertical when the
portrait is vertical? The wrong date on yours with the poor obverse
lettering makes it a fake I am sure. :.
